INSTALLATION
(1) Install the assembled engine assembly into the
engine compartment. Be certain the engine mount
insulator studs are inserted through the frame rail
brackets.
(2) Remove the engine lifting device. Install an
engine support fixture, if necessary.
(3) Raise the vehicle on the hoist.
(4) Install the left and right engine mount insula-
tor retaining nuts. Torque the nuts to 65 N·m (48 ft.
lbs.).
(5) Position the transmission assembly and install
the clutch bellhousing retaining bolts. Torque the
bolts to 88 N·m (65 ft. lbs.).
NOTE: Do not install the 3 o–clock positioned bell-
housing bolt at this time. This bolt is used to sup-
port the exhaust system.
(6) Install the misfire sensor on the clutch bell-
housing. Torque the bolts to 27 N·m (20 ft. lbs.).
(7) Install the shifter on the transmission (Fig. 14).
Torque the bolts to 27 N·m (20 ft. lbs.).
(8) Connect all wiring to the transmission in its
original position.
(9) Raise the transmission assembly enough to
position the rear support crossmember.

(10) Install the transmission support crossmember.
Torque the bolts to 65 N·m (48 ft. lbs.).
(11) Install the fuelline support bracket on the
transmission support crossmember.
(12) Install the (4) transmission mount retaining
nuts on the transmission support crossmember (Fig.
15). Torque the nuts to 47 N·m (35 ft. lbs.).
(13) Install the clutch slave cylinder and the (2)
retaining nuts (Fig. 16). Torque the nuts to 40 N·m
(30 ft. lbs.).
(14) Install the exhaust system support bracket
nut on the transmission support crossmember (Fig.
15). Torque the nut to 67 N·m (50 ft. lbs.).
(15) Install the exhaust system support bracket
bolt in the clutch bellhousing. Torque the bolt to 88
N·m (65 ft. lbs.).
(16) Install the (2) exhaust system inlet pipe
retaining nuts. Torque the nuts to 36 N·m (27 ft.
lbs.).
(17) Install the propeller shaft assembly in the
vehicle. Install the (4) center bearing retaining nuts
and torque to 61 N·m (45 ft. lbs.).
(18) Remove the tape and position the rear univer-
sal joint in the rear axle companion flange. Install
the universal joint clamps and torque the retaining
bolts to 27 N·m (20 ft. lbs.).
(19) Lower the vehicle on the hoist.
(20) Install the body ground wire coming from the
negative battery cable end.
(21) Install the 12v feed wire coming from the pos-
itive battery cable end. Torque the nut to 12 N·m
(105 in. lbs.).
(22) Connect all remaining wiring coming from the
engine assembly in its original position.
(23) Install the lower radiator hose on the engine
assembly.
(24) Install the power steering fluid supply hose on
the power steering pump.
(25) Install the power steering fluid pressure line
on the power steering pump. Torque the nut to 28
N·m (21 ft. lbs.).
(26) Connect the power brake vacuum supply hose
on the engine assembly (Fig. 17).
(27) Install the fuel / water separator and mount-
ing bracket.
(28) Install the clutch fluid reservoir (Fig. 17).
Torque the nuts to 12 N·m (105 in. lbs.).
(29) Install and secure the fuel lines (Fig. 17) in
there original positions.
(30) Connect the electrical connectors to the bot-
tom of the fuel / water separator (Fig. 17).
(31) Connect the heater core coolant supply hoses
on the engine assembly.
(32) Install the fan shroud over the cooling fan.

(33) Install the radiator and intercooler as an
assembly.
(34) Install the (2) upper fan shroud retaining
bolts (Fig. 18). Torque the bolts to 12 N·m (105 in.
lbs.).
(35) Install the intercooler inlet and outlet hoses.
(36) Connect the air intake hose on the turbo-
charger and install the air cleaner assembly.
(37) Install the upper radiator hose on the engine
(Fig. 18).
(38) Connect the coolant supply hoses on the cool-
ant reservoir (Fig. 19).
(39) Install the coolant reservoir on the bulkhead
(Fig. 19).
(40) Connect the coolant level sensor electrical con-
nector (Fig. 19).
(41) Connect the EGR solenoid vacuum line (Fig.
19).
(42) Connect the EGR solenoid electrical connector
(Fig. 19).
(43) Install the coolant hose on the water manifold
(Fig. 19).
(44) Install the coolant overflow hoses on the cool-
ant reservoir (Fig. 19).

(45) Position the refrigerant lines in the vehicle
and install the support bracket bolts in the generator
bracket and water manifold.
(46) Connect the refrigerant line at the A/C accu-
mulator (Fig. 20), making sure the sealing o-rings
are well lubricated with R134a oil and free of tears.
Install the secondary clip.
(47) Connect the refrigerant line at the A/C con-
denser (Fig. 21), making sure the sealing o-rings are
well lubricated with R134a oil and free of tears.
Install the secondary clip.
(48) Install the refrigerant line support bracket on
the A/C condenser.
(49) Install the A/C condenser support bolts in the
front closure panel. Torque the bolts to 22 N·m (200
in. lbs.).
(50) Install the upper radiator support (Fig. 22).
Torque the bolts to 33 N·m (25 ft. lbs.).
(51) Install the cowl grille (Fig. 23). (Refer to 23 -
BODY/EXTERIOR/COWL
GRILLE
-
INSTALLA-
TION).
(52) Raise the vehicle on the hoist.
(53) Install both refrigerant lines on the compres-
sor (Fig. 24), making sure the sealing o-rings are well
lubricated with R-134A refrigerant oil and free of
tears. Torque the bolts to 22 N·m (200 in. lbs.).
(54) Install the (2) lower fan shroud retaining
bolts. Torque the bolts to 12 N·m (105 in. lbs.).
(55) Install the lower radiator hose on the engine
assembly.
